ऋग्वेद १.३२.८

Ṛgveda 1.32.8

ṛṣi
हिरण्यस्तूप आङ्गिरसः
devatā
इन्द्रः
chandas
त्रिष्टुप्

na̱daṃ na bhi̱nnama̍mu̱yā śayā̍na̱ṃ mano̱ ruhā̍ṇā̱ ati̍ ya̱ntyāpa̍ḥ |yāści̍dvṛ̱tro ma̍hi̱nā pa̱ryati̍ṣṭha̱ttāsā̱mahi̍ḥ patsuta̱ḥśīrba̍bhūva ||

Transliteration IAST

na̱daṃ na bhi̱nnama̍mu̱yā śayā̍na̱ṃ mano̱ ruhā̍ṇā̱ ati̍ ya̱ntyāpa̍ḥ | yāści̍dvṛ̱tro ma̍hi̱nā pa̱ryati̍ṣṭha̱ttāsā̱mahi̍ḥ patsuta̱ḥśīrba̍bhūva ||

Padapāṭha word by word, as recited

नदम् | न | भिन्नम् | अमुया | शयानम् | मनः | रुहाणाः | अति | यन्ति | आपः | याः | चित् | वृत्रः | महिना | परि-अतिष्ठत् | तासाम् | अहिः | पत्सुतःशीः | बभूव

nadam | na | bhinnam | amuyā | śayānam | manaḥ | ruhāṇāḥ | ati | yanti | āpaḥ | yāḥ | cit | vṛtraḥ | mahinā | pari-atiṣṭhat | tāsām | ahiḥ | patsutaḥśīḥ | babhūva

Translations signed

There as he lies like a bank-bursting river, the waters taking courage flow above him. The Dragon lies beneath the feet of torrents which Vṛitra with his greatness had encompassed.

Ralph T.H. GriffithThe Hymns of the Rigveda, translated with a popular commentary, 1896 · public domain
